Position Summary:

The Executive Director is directly respon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of Catholic Cemeteries and to establish and coordinate cemetery expansion, development and operations and uphold the traditions and standards of the Roman Catholic Church as it relates to Christian burial. Additional duties as they relate to the establishment of all policies and procedures as they pertain to Catholic Cemeteries.
